Company Description

Mural, also known as Tactivos, develops a digital whiteboard workspace for team collaboration. The platform is used by go-to-market teams in industries like financial services, technology, and consulting, with a user base that includes more than half of the Fortune 100 companies. Its features include AI tools, workflows, templates, sticky notes, and diagramming. Founded in 2011, the company has raised a total of $193.1 million in funding over seven rounds, achieving a market valuation of $2 billion as of July 2021.

Mural's recent focus has been on enhancing its platform with artificial intelligence and expanding its integration capabilities. The company introduced an AI Clustering feature designed to organize qualitative data such as interview transcripts and user feedback. It also announced two-way sync integrations with project management and CRM platforms including Salesforce, Asana, and Jira. Alongside product development, Mural has released playbooks for sales and R&D teams and collaborated with companies like IBM on webinars focused on using human-centered design for team alignment.

MURAL Founders

  • Co-Founder, Mariano Suarez-Battan
  • Co-Founder, Agustin Soler
  • Co-Founder, Patricio Jutard

What is MURAL's stock ticker symbol?

MURAL is a private company, so it does not have a stock ticker symbol. Ticker symbols are only assigned to companies when they become publicly traded on a stock exchange.
